The Benefits of Distant Learning among Students, COVID-19

There is a financial case for several institutions implementing a formalized remote training system because COVID-19 has led institutions to shut down.

The academic industry has already been devastated either by the current COVID-19 pandemic. Numerous pupils could not attend college or finish their education as part of the compulsory closure of institutions. Given the confluence of such elements, some researchers and teachers have begun to wonder if it makes sense for such an institution to fund a regular distance training system.

Overall cost-effectiveness of digital training, when opposed to regular attending courses, has been the foundation of the business basis for this.

Although opposed to traditional classes and instructor pay, which arfrequently very expensive for institutions, alternative learning solutions are typically relatively outlaid.

Additionally, the tools needed for online instruction are less costly than those used in formal education systems, like desktops and projections. An academy can deliver a top-notch curriculum for a lot less money if it implements a remote training system instead of continuing to give regular class training.

Benefits of Online Learning for Rural and Disabled Learners in the COVID-19 Era

Due to work and other responsibilities, learners that do not have the opportunity to join regular classes also can acquire top-notch online services. However, digital learning is growing accepted as people begin recognizing its teaching advantage. Learners who reside in rural places where it has been challenging or impractical to join conventional schools or universities may find that being of particular benefit.

Online classes also give disabled students or special needs education opportunities while constantly worrying approximately navigating obstacles like steps like accessibility ladders that would be too tough for all of them in reality.
